Your right, it's not cheap for a phone holder. Have been using Brodit for years and the quality is fine. The active ones from my pervious N73 and N96 which i both used for 2 years survived just fine, and no damage to the phones.
The base plate is steady and easy holds a TomTom XXL without moving at all. My 4S came in saturday the holder on monday, but i have the wrong bumper on the phone so it's does not fit. The right bumper is comming tomorrow.
For the iPhone 4 brodit has 3 kind of holders. Phone with bumper, phone with skin or naked phone. Nice!
You could buy the sig plug version (cheaper) and connect it with a contra sig plug behind the glovebox.
I decided not to buy the active one this time. I'm not gonna use the phone for navigation so the battery wil hold long enough. In an emergency I can always use the original charger which wil fit when phone is in the holder.
In my Civic i did not use the pro clip, screwed the holder right into the dash, looks better, if you don't mind holes in the dash. The new owner of the civic also bought a Brodit and reuse the holes.
